New York Sports Betting Report Sees Surge

The New York sports betting report shows a surge in online sports betting in the state, giving the market a great start to the year. Our latest gambling industry news starts with a bang. The New York State Gaming Commission reports that $410.8 million in wagers were placed during the week ending January 1.

This gives us the highest weekly handle reported since November. And it is also a huge jump in handle from the previous week’s $352.6 million. And those who manage their own pay per head sportsbook will want to note that the gross gaming revenue of the state’s online sportsbooks are at $23.9 million. This is down from the previous week’s $37.8 million. The hold percentage was 5.8%

New York Sports Betting Report Sees SurgeThe report also tells us that we are seeing 8 straight weeks of seeing sportsbooks in the state take in wagers more than $400 million weekly. These are great numbers, considering that online sports betting has been legal for barely a year, having launched back in January 2022. And that is not the only record the state has made.

Last year, New Jersey say $10.6 billion in sports wagers. New York beat that with $16.2 billion in its first year. It is truly a record-setting year for the state, considering that they only have 9 online sports betting operators. Its also not surprising, since it took the state only 16 days to hit $1 billion in wagers when sports betting started in the state.
